Output 52fdf54bbbd016c2925b8dd622a772b0577b057e685bfb666d2ff663a7639c60:0

value
2148
script pubkey
OP_0 OP_PUSHBYTES_20 5c63bbe8d6efbe1170b43fb73926681e3583f2cd
address
tb1qt33mh6xka7lpzu9587mnjfngrc6c8ukdjfzdcc
transaction
52fdf54bbbd016c2925b8dd622a772b0577b057e685bfb666d2ff663a7639c60
confirmations
27948
spent
true